Preliminary Apprehension and Booking



When you're pulled over for thought dui, the initial arrest and reservation procedure can feel frustrating. It often begins with the policeman asking you to get out of your car. You may be asked to do field sobriety examinations or take a breath analyzer. If the officer thinks you're impaired, they'll apprehend you and take you to the station.

Once you show up, the booking procedure begins. You'll be fingerprinted, photographed, and asked to give personal information. This step can really feel intrusive, but it's guideline. Your belongings will certainly be taken for safekeeping, and you could be placed in a holding cell, relying on the circumstance.

During this time, remember you have rights. It's essential not to answer inquiries that can incriminate you without an attorney present. If you can not pay for one, the court will designate a public defender for you.

After scheduling, you'll wait on your bond hearing, where the court will establish your release problems. It's necessary to stay calm and respectful throughout the process, as your behavior can influence the policemans and the judge's understandings of you.

Court Proceedings



Court process adhering to a DWI arrest can be daunting and complicated. Once you're charged, you'll receive a summons to appear in court. It's vital to attend this hearing, as falling short to do so can cause added penalties, including a warrant for your arrest.

During your first court appearance, called an arraignment, you'll formally listen to the charges against you. You'll likewise have the opportunity to enter a plea-- guilty, innocent, or no competition. If you plead not guilty, the court will certainly establish a day for a pre-trial hearing, where you and your attorney can review potential plea bargains or prepare for test.

Potential Penalties and Outcomes



Dealing with a DWI fee can lead to a variety of fines that vary relying on a number of elements, including your blood alcohol focus (BAC) degree, prior offenses, and whether there were intensifying conditions, like an accident or injury.

If it's your very first infraction, you might deal with penalties, permit suspension, and potentially compulsory alcohol education and learning classes. Nonetheless, if your BAC was particularly high or if you've had prior sentences, fines can intensify considerably.

For a second or third offense, you could be considering increased fines, longer license suspensions, and even prison time. In some cases, setup of an ignition interlock device could be required to gain back driving privileges.

If you created a mishap or injury while driving intoxicated, the effects can be even more serious, consisting of felony costs and significant prison time.
